Six Ohio State football players were among the individuals who graduated from the university Sunday, including Joshua Perry and Michael Thomas. 

Perry, a senior linebacker whose degree is in family resource management, and Thomas, a junior receiver who majored in sport industry, were both starters last year when the Buckeyes won the national championship. 

Thomas is Ohio State's leading receiver with 49 catches for 709 yards and eight touchdowns. He caught 54 passes for 799 yards and nine touchdowns last season.  

Thomas has a year of eligibility left and has yet to declare whether or not he will use it or enter the NFL draft.

Perry is second on the team with 98 tackles this season, including 7.5 for loss. He led the national champion Buckeyes in stops last season with 124, including 8.5 for loss. 

Two other reserves on the national championship team -- receiver Jeff Greene (sport industry) and linebacker Camren Williams (communication) -- also graduated along with two players from the late 1990s. 

Ben Gilbert (family resource management) was a three-year starter on the Ohio State offensive line from 1997-99 while Reggie Germany (sociology) was a two-year starter and led the team with 43 catches for 656 yards in 1999. 

Urban Meyer and Cardale Jones were among those to congratulate the new graduates.
